Antitrust / Competition Law

Antitrust law books focus on the legal frameworks governing competition and market regulation. These titles delve into key topics such as monopolies, anti-competitive practices, and regulatory compliance. They are essential for legal practitioners, corporate counsel, and students specializing in competition law. Leading publishers like Sweet & Maxwell, LexisNexis, and CCH offer comprehensive resources that provide insights into case law, enforcement actions, and economic analysis relevant to antitrust issues.
